I'm kind of lost as to what to do with these gloves I bought less than a year ago when I was in panama city. They have 2 dives in panama city when i bought them and 1 dive in a local quarry today in which the thumb started to unravel at the seems.

I would take them back to the "LDS" except they are >5 hours away and I can't remember the name of the shop. Is there anyway I can warranty these or do I just need to toss them in the trash?
 
All Akona products have a 2 year warranty. You can contact any authorized Akona dealer (you do not need to physically go to the store) by phone or email and let them know your situation. The dealer will contact Akona to get this resolved. We will need you to provide your proof of purchase when sending in the gloves. The dealer will provide the name, address and vital Return Authorization number to get this processed.
